Transaction 65166310be1dd01da4f32473e87076e8bf24571ce61f95895f580e68b16c8547
1 Input
1 Output
-
65166310be1dd01da4f32473e87076e8bf24571ce61f95895f580e68b16c8547:0
- value
- 1037183
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24542e8150d3aff79d46ee93b0d1fb5ba3c5f994 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14K6Ax7YaJHtEuazHoz7kcTTowu4o2eLaV